For short term visits we have listed some hostels/hotels/guest apartments within the walking distance from the University Main Building. Most of the listed hotels should be able to offer University discount. If you stay in Tartu for few months, you could consider staying in one of the Student Village dormitories, which provide comfortable and favourably priced accommodation or in Academus Hostel, Arco Vara Guest Apartments or Tartu Home Apartments. For renting a flat you would most probably want to visit the flat before you sign the agreement. For this you could stay a short period in the hostel or a guest apartment listed below in order to have more time to get aquainted with the real estate offers. Note that the owner of the premises may require 1 or 2 months’ rent in advance or a deposit upon signing the lease agreement. The tenant can demand repayment of the deposit in case the owner has not informed the tenant of any claims against him within of two months after the expiry of the lease contract. Real-estate companies charge a fee usually in the value of the amount of 1 month rent. Please note that the utility costs as well as telephone, and internet connection bills will be usually added to the advertised rent, unless agreed otherwise. Taxes related to the property are paid by the landlord. You should keep the property in tact and remove minor defects that can be removed by light cleaning of maintenance which are in any case necessary for the ordinary usage and preservation of the rented property. Ask also for the offers for cleaning services (for extra costs) from the real estate company. For any improvements or alterations at the property you need the owners written consent. If the value of the property increases because of the alterations, the tenant can ask for compensation. It is advisable to agree on the compensation for alterations or improvements in advance. In case you have a rental agreement with an unspecified term and the owner wants to raise the rent, he has to inform you 30 days beforehand in written form.
